COS Donates Over 8,000 Pounds Of Food To Chattanooga Area Food Bank

  • Monday, August 8, 2016
photo by Derryberry PR
COS Office Supplies is continuing its 75th anniversary celebration through its successful “Food Trucks for Food Bank” food drive.  COS sent collection boxes out with its drivers to customers located throughout the region to collect food to meet summer needs. The campaign collected over 8,000 pounds of food providing more than 6,500 meals to those in need throughout the region.

On Saturday, COS team members and their families went to the Food Bank for a work day in further support of the important work done by the Food Bank.
Team members washed trucks, peeled and bagged onions, labeled foods and prepared boxes to meet community need.

“It’s so impressive to see how far the Chattanooga Area Food Bank stretches the resources provided to them,” said COS President Skip Ireland.  “We’ve been fortunate to have support that has allowed us to be in business for the last 75 years, it’s important to us to give back to the community that has done so much for us.”
